Retained Earnings
The portion of a company's profit that is held or retained and saved for future use, investment, or to pay debt, rather than being distributed to shareholders as dividends.
After-tax Earnings
The net income a company generates after all taxes have been deducted from total revenue.
Capital Structure
The mix of a company's long-term debt, specific short-term debt, common equity, and preferred equity which is used to finance its overall operations and growth.
Residual Dividend Policy
A strategy where dividends are paid after all project capital needs and working capital requirements are met.
